Adaptive changes of ROS/RNS redox and melatonin synthesis under salt and waterlogging stresses in Pittosporum tobira

Xiaojiao Pan,
Pengcheng Wang,
Mingjun Teng
et al.

Abstract: Plants have evolved a variety of complex mechanisms to resist the environmental factors including salt and waterlogging stresses. In this study, we described adaptive changes of Pittosporum tobira toward salt and/or waterlogging stresses by mediating ROS (reactive oxygen species)/RNS (reactive nitrogen species) redox and melatonin synthesis.
